What is Debian and why is the global community coming to Argentina?
Debian is one of the most important free software projects in the world. It is built by a large community of developers and volunteers working together to create a universal and stable operating system. This talk aims to introduce the Debian Project, how it is organized, how its community works, and why it is so relevant at a global level. We will also highlight what lies behind such a major event as DebConf and why, after more than a decade, it is returning to our country in 2026 (DebConf26) in Santa Fe. We will share experiences, stories, and how you can get involved in this project and its community, regardless of your technical background.
